Preparing Cranberry Spinach Stuffed Chicken

When it comes to dinner ideas that are as impressive as they are delicious, cranberry spinach stuffed chicken is a crowd-pleaser that’s simple enough for a weeknight meal yet elegant enough for entertaining guests. This dish combines juicy chicken breasts, leafy spinach, tangy cranberries, and creamy Brie cheese for a harmonious blend of flavors. Let’s dive into the preparation, step by step!

Prepare the chicken breasts

The first step in crafting your cranberry spinach stuffed chicken is preparing the chicken breasts. You’ll want to start with fresh, boneless, skinless chicken breasts for the best results.

  • Place each chicken breast on a cutting board. Using a sharp knife, carefully cut a pocket into the side of each breast. Be gentle—your goal is to create a space for the delectable stuffing without slicing all the way through.
  • Once your chicken is ready, you can set it aside while you focus on the next steps!

Seasoning the chicken for the perfect flavor

To ensure your chicken is full of flavor, it’s essential to season it properly. Consider a combination of the following:

  • Salt and pepper: The classics never fail! Generously season both the inside and outside of each chicken breast.
  • Garlic powder: For an extra layer of flavor, sprinkle some garlic powder over the chicken.
  • Herbs: Optional but recommended are dried herbs like thyme or rosemary. They add a delightful aromatic note to your dish.

Don’t hesitate to get in there with your hands and rub those seasonings into the chicken! It’s a simple step that enhances the overall taste of your cranberry spinach stuffed chicken.

Sautéing the spinach

Now comes the fun part—sautéing the spinach! This step takes just a few minutes and is crucial for achieving that perfect filling.

  • In a medium skillet, heat a t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at.
  • Add in roughly 2 cups of fresh spinach (about one bag) and cook for about 2-3 minutes or until wilted.
  • Don’t forget to stir occasionally to keep it from burning. Cooking spinach not only makes it easier to fold into the stuffing but also enhances its flavor.

Once the spinach is perfectly sautéed, you can proceed to mix in the cranberries.

Mixing in the cranberries and stuffing the chicken

Now it’s time to create your savory stuffing.

  • In a bowl, combine the sautéed spinach with about half a cup of dried cranberries and 4 ounces of creamy Brie cheese (cut into small pieces).
  • Mix everything together until evenly distributed and season with a pinch of salt and pepper.
  • To stuff each chicken breast, use a tablespoon or your fingers to carefully fill the pocket you created earlier. Don’t be afraid to overfill a bit—more stuffing equals more deliciousness!

Searing and baking the chicken for juicy results

You’ve done all the hard work; now it’s time to cook your creation to perfection.

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In the same skillet you used for the spinach, add a little more oil over medium-high heat.
  3. Sear each stuffed chicken breast for about 3-4 minutes on each side until they’re golden brown. This helps lock in the juices as they bake.
  4. After searing, transfer the chicken breasts to a baking dish and pop them in the oven. Bake for about 20-25 minutes or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).

Cooking Tips and Notes for Cranberry Spinach Stuffed Chicken

Ensuring the chicken stays juicy

To ensure your cranberry spinach stuffed chicken comes out tender and juicy every time, consider brining the chicken breasts for at least 30 minutes before cooking. This simple step enhances moisture retention. Also, when you’re cooking, don’t overload the pan—this can lower the temperature and lead to uneven cooking. Adding a splash of chicken broth or using a cooking method that involves liquid, like braising, can help maintain that mouthwatering juiciness.

Alternative cooking methods

While baking in the oven is a fan favorite for this recipe, you can also explore other cooking methods. Try grilling for a smoky flavor or using a slow cooker, which infuses the chicken with moisture and tenderness. If you’re short on time, a stovetop skillet works wonders—just be sure to cover it while cooking to keep everything nice and steamy. FAQs about Cranberry Spinach Stuffed Chicken

Can I use fresh cranberries instead of dried cranberries?

Absolutely! Using fresh cranberries will add a delightful tartness to your dish. However, keep in mind that fresh cranberries are more acidic compared to their dried counterparts. If you choose to go this route, you might want to balance the flavors by adding a touch of honey or brown sugar to your stuffing mixture. For guidance on how to best use fresh cranberries, check out this helpful resource from Better Homes & Gardens.

What can I use as a substitute for brie cheese?

If brie isn’t available, don’t fret! You can substitute it with other creamy cheeses like camembert, cream cheese, or even goat cheese. Each option will slightly alter the flavor profile, but they’ll still create a delicious, melty filling for your cranberry spinach stuffed chicken. Just remember that goat cheese has a sharper taste, while cream cheese will lend a milder, smoother texture.

How do I know when the chicken is cooked through?

To ensure your chicken is perfectly cooked, aim for an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C). A meat thermometer is your best friend here; it provides an accurate measurement without cutting into your chicken. If you don’t have one handy, check that the juices run clear when you pierce the chicken with a knife. Undercooked chicken can pose health risks, so always prioritize food safety. Cranberry Spinach Stuffed Chicken: Easy Recipe with Brie Delight

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

Enjoy this delightful Cranberry & Spinach Stuffed Chicken recipe with creamy Brie cheese. Perfect for a cozy dinner!

  • Author: Souzan
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Category: Main Dish
  • Method: Baking, Searing
  • Cuisine: American
  • Diet: Gluten-Free

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 chicken breasts
  • 1 cup fresh spinach
  • 1/2 cup cranberry sauce
  • 8 ounces Brie cheese
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 cup breadcrumbs

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a bowl, mix the spinach, cranberry sauce, and diced Brie together.
  3. Cut a pocket into each chicken breast and stuff with the cranberry-spinach mixture.
  4. Season the chicken with gar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
  5.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at and sear the stuffed chicken on both sides until golden brown.
  6. Transfer the chicken to a baking dish, sprinkle breadcrumbs on top, and bake for 25-30 minutes.
  7. Let it rest for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

  • Feel free to substitute the Brie with another cheese if desired.
  • Ensure ch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C).
